Aduana Stars: A Fortress at Home
Aduana Stars, the Fire Boys, are in a transitional phase. But their home ground remains a fortress. They haven't lost in their last 16 home matches. Against Hearts of Oak, they boast an impressive record: 7 wins, 3 draws, and just 1 loss in their last 11 home encounters. The most common scoreline? A 1-0 victory for Aduana Stars. History favors them, and the stats back it up.
Hearts of Oak: Struggling on the Road
Hearts of Oak, despite their rich history, have struggled away from home. They've failed to score in 4 of their 7 away matches this season. Their last victory at Aduana Stars' ground was back in 2014. Coach Grant is trying to steer the team in a positive direction, but the road is tough. Their recent 0-0 draw against Samartex highlights their defensive strength but also their offensive struggles.
